In this talk I will be discussing a new ultracold molecules experiment that I'm setting up at Durham University. Ultracold molecules offer possibilities for a range of applications from controlled chemistry and testing beyond standard model physics, to quantum simulation. In this talk I will focus on what makes cold molecules promising candidates for these applications, and how we are working towards harnessing power this experimentally.
